2025 年您应该了解的 10 大 DevOps 趋势

2025 年您应该了解的 10 大 DevOps 趋势

科技

在数字世界中,DevOps 凭借其强大、可扩展和高效的特性,近年来持续快速增长。 2025 年,DevOps 的目标是让软件开发更快、更安全、更高效。

人工智能(AI)、机器学习、增强安全工具、智能基础设施管理和复杂的 Kubernetes 系统等趋势在全球 DevOps 市场规模预测中越来越受欢迎,2023 年 DevOps 市场价值将达到 105 亿美元。预计2024-2035年复合年增长率为21.01%。

目录:

在本博客中,我们将了解 DevOps 是什么、它的好处、需求以及 2025 年将遵循的十大趋势。

什么是 DevOps?

DevOps 是一种将软件开发 (Dev) 和 IT 运营 (Ops) 结合起来的工作方式,可以更快、更高效地构建、测试和发布软件产品。它注重团队合作、自动化和持续改进。在这里,开发人员和运营人员共同努力确保软件顺利运行。 DevOps 使用工具自动执行重复性任务,例如测试和部署。这个过程比任何其他传统的软件开发过程都更先进、更快。

根据 DevOps Pulse 的数据,15% 的公司计划在未来几年使用 DevOps,而 9% 的公司尚未开始实施。

DevOps 有哪些好处?

以下是 DevOps 的一些主要优势:

  • 改进协作: DevOps 就像开发人员和 IT 运营之间的一座桥梁。他们共同协作并确保软件顺利运行。
  • 可扩展性: DevOps可以帮助我们提高软件开发和部署的稳定性和速度。
  • 自动化: DevOps 可以自动化我们的工作,例如重复性任务、测试、部署等。
  • 安全: DevOps 可以让我们的应用程序更加安全。

紧跟最新的 DevOps 趋势

加入我们的 DevOps 课程,掌握热门技能

测验图标测验图标



DevOps 需求量大吗?

是的,DevOps 的需求量很大,因为它可以帮助公司更快、更可靠地交付软件。它充当开发人员和运营团队之间的桥梁,使沟通更快、更顺畅。

如今,大约 77% 的公司正在使用 DevOps 来部署其应用程序。此外,根据 2022 年 DevOps 状况报告,50% 的 DevOps 采用者被认为是高绩效组织。这就是为什么 DevOps 是 2024 年及以后需求最高的技能之一。

以下是 2025 年及以后将遵循的一些 DevOps 趋势:

1. 开发安全运营

DevSecOps 代表开发、安全和运营。这种方法将安全性集成到软件开发的每个阶段,使其成为所有团队成员的共同责任。它确保尽快在软件中实施安全措施,以降低与之相关的风险。这种做法强调协作、自动化和持续监控,以加快部署速度

2.AIOps/MLOps

DevOps 中的 AIOps/MLOps 是一组使用人工智能 (AI) 和机器学习 (ML) 来自动化 IT 操作(例如监控、管理和决策)的实践。人工智能和机器学习在 DevOps 效率方面发挥着重要作用。随着 AI/ML 的发展,DevOps 也提高了应用程序的效率和速度。

3. 库伯内特斯

Kubernetes 通过简化容器化应用程序管理彻底改变了 DevOps,从而促进了软件部署、扩展和管理。它可以自动执行负载平衡、扩展和监控等任务,从而减少手动工作。它只是一个开源平台,开发者可以用它来管理多云环境、自动化部署等。Kubernetes 1.0 版本于 2015 年 7 月 21 日发布;此后,这种 DevOps 趋势呈指数级增长。

4. 码头工人

Docker 是开源软件,允许开发人员将应用程序及其依赖项打包到单元中。 Docker 广泛用于 DevOps 中,以简化开发、测试和生产工作流程。

5. 容器化

容器化是将应用程序及其依赖项打包到单个轻量级容器中的过程,该容器可以在不同环境中一致运行。它将应用程序与底层系统隔离,确保无论是在开发人员的计算机、服务器还是在云上,它的行为都是相同的。

6. 基础设施即代码

DevOps 中的基础设施即代码 (IaC) 是一种使用代码而不是手动流程来管理基础设施(如服务器、网络和存储)的实践。它有助于自动化设置,减少人为错误,并确保开发、测试和生产环境保持一致。这是加速部署和扩展同时提高可靠性的关键 DevOps 趋势

7. 站点可靠性工程(SRE)

SRE 是将软件工程原理应用于 IT 运营的学科,从而创建可扩展且高度可靠的软件系统。创建健壮、可扩展且高度安全的软件系统在组织中很受欢迎。 DevOps 专注于协作和端到端应用程序生命周期。而SRE则侧重于系统的可靠性和可扩展性。

通过免费培训快速开启您的 DevOps 工程师职业生涯

免费访问专家主导的 DevOps 课程

测验图标测验图标



8. 多云环境

在软件开发中,云计算是重要组成部分之一,在行业中脱颖而出发挥着重要作用。如今,企业不仅希望将其应用程序部署在单个云平台上,还希望将其部署在多个云平台上。 DevOps 团队主要依赖多云将工作分散到 AWS、Azure 和 Google Cloud 等云平台上,以使他们的应用程序更加灵活、可访问和可靠。

9.无服务器计算

无服务器计算是指云计算模型,其中云提供商管理基础设施、扩展和服务器,这将允许开发人员只关注编码部分。这可能会节省成本、提高可扩展性并加快开发周期。

10. 自动化

DevOps 中的自动化涉及使用工具和脚本来简化整个软件开发生命周期中的重复任务。它可实现更快的部署、一致的配置和高效的资源管理。自动化的常见领域包括 CI/CD 管道、测试和监控。

2025 年将使用以下 DevOps 工具。

区域 工具
版本控制与协作 Git、Github、GitLab 和 Bitbucket
持续集成和持续交付(CI/CD) Jenkins、GitLab CI/CD、CircleCI 和 GitHub Actions
基础设施即代码 (IaC) 和配置管理: Terraform、Pulumi、Ansible 和 Chef
容器化和编排: 库伯内斯、码头工人
云平台和无服务器 AWS、Azure 和 GCP
监控和可观察性 Datadog、New Relic 和 Dynatrace
开发安全运营 Snyk、Aqua Security 和 Twistlock
AIOps/MLOps Moogsoft、BigPanda 和 Dynatrace AIOps

获得 100% 的徒步旅行!

立即掌握最需要的技能!

DevOps 的未来

DevOps 的未来是美好的,它将专注于更多的自动化,使流程更快、更高效。云原生技术和无服务器架构将继续增长,从而降低基础设施维护成本。人工智能和机器学习将用于更智能的监控和更好的性能。随着 DevOps 的发展,它将变得更具协作性和适应性,帮助团队交付运行速度快且更可靠的高质量软件。

结论

总之,多云环境、无服务器计算、自动化和先进的 CI/CD 管道等 DevOps 趋势正在重塑团队开发和部署软件的方式。这些趋势侧重于提高可扩展性、效率和速度,同时降低基础设施复杂性。 Kubernetes、Terraform 和无服务器框架等工具正在帮助团队实现无缝集成和更快的交付周期。

随着技术的发展,紧跟这些趋势对于成功至关重要。添加这些趋势可确保企业保持敏捷和创新。 DevOps 的使用者 全球 80% 的组织。因此,DevOps 是 2025 年最重要的技能之一。如果您想成为 DevOps 专家并培养需求技能,可以报名参加我们的综合 DevOps 课程。

AI 会取代 DevOps 吗?

人工智能将通过自动化重复任务和改进决策来增强 DevOps,而不是完全取代它。

2024年DevOps的趋势是什么?

DevOps 趋势包括人工智能、机器学习、安全、无服务器计算、多云环境、自动化等。

网络安全在现代 DevOps 实践中扮演什么角色?

网络安全通过确保安全性集成在整个开发生命周期中,在现代 DevOps 中发挥着重要作用。

DevOps 需要编码吗?

是的,DevOps 需要一些基本的编码来自动化任务、构建管道等。